Abstract

Global access to knowledge is one of the most interesting challenges for librarians at the moment. Network cooperation at the local, regional, national and international level is essential to achieve this goal. The Ministry of Culture´s library policy in recent years has allowed for the creation of the needed cooperation structures so that all administrations and all types of libraries can collaborate together in projects and initiatives targeted at the joint development of their networks and systems, which provides for the acknowledgement of libraries as key democratic institutions in education, cultural, social and research and development policies.
